A friendly and supportive primary school in North Somerset is seeking an enthusiastic and proactive Unqualified Teaching Assistant to join their team after the Easter break.

This role is ideal for someone who has experience working with children in informal or community settings such as sports coaching, youth work, mentoring, holiday/summer camps or childcare. No formal TA qualifications are required, just the right attitude, resilience and a passion for helping young learners thrive.

As a Teaching Assistant, you will:
- Support the class teacher with daily routines, activities and classroom organisation
- Work 1:1 and with small groups to help pupils stay engaged and progress
- Assist with behaviour management using positive, consistent strategies
- Support children with communication, confidence, emotional wellbeing and participation
- Help prepare resources and set up engaging learning environments
- Supervise pupils during breaktimes, transitions and group activities
- Be a positive role model, building strong relationships with pupils
- Work closely with the teacher and wider staff team to create an inclusive classroom

We are seeking individuals who have:
- Experience in sports coaching, youth work, mentoring, playwork, summer camps or other child‑focused roles (highly desirable)
- A patient, energetic and supportive approach
- Strong communication and teamwork skills
- A positive attitude and willingness to learn
- Confidence managing groups of children
- Reliability, resilience and a commitment to supporting young learners
- An Enhanced DBS on the Update Service (or willingness to obtain one)
